HOUSTON, Aug. 10, 2017 -- CADWorx® & Analysis Solutions will host a PV Elite webinar on August 22, 2017 at 10:00 a.m. CDT that will discuss the latest ASME code updates for pressure vessel and heat exchanger design that will become mandatory January 2018. These important changes in the code will affect the calculations of engineers involved in designing and analyzing these types of components. Webinar participants will learn about the impact these modifications will have in the design of pressure vessels and heat exchangers. The webinar leader will be Ray Delaforce, senior support engineer for PV Elite and TANK software at Hexagon PPM.

About CADWorx & Analysis Solutions
CADWorx & Analysis Solutions is part of Hexagon PPM. It develops and supports the following products: CADWorx, for plant design; CAESAR II, for pipe stress analysis; PV Elite and Visual Vessel Design, for pressure vessel analysis; TANK, for storage tank analysis; and GT STRUDL, for structural analysis.
A division of Hexagon, Hexagon PPM is a leading global provider of engineering software for the design, construction and operation of plants, ships and offshore facilities.
